Win32_SystemSlot

The Win32_SystemSlot class represents physical connection points including ports, motherboard slots and peripherals, and proprietary connections points.

Quick Start

Properties

In this WMI class, all WMI properties are read-only. You can only read values but not change them.

Caption

Data type String

The Caption property is a short textual description (one-line string) of the object.

ConnectorPinout

Data type String

A free-form string describing the pin configuration and signal usage of a physical connector.

ConnectorType

Data type UInt16

The ConnectorType property indicates the physical attributes of the connector used by this slot.

Example: 2 25 (Male RS-232)

CreationClassName

Data type String

CreationClassName indicates the name of the class or the subclass used in the creation of an instance. When used with the other key properties of this class, this property allows all instances of this class and its subclasses to be uniquely identified.

CurrentUsage

Data type UInt16

The CurrentUsage property indicates the current usage of the system slot.

Values are: “Reserved” (0), “Other” (1), “Unknown” (2), “Available” (3), “In Use” (4)

Description

Data type String

The Description property provides a textual description of the object.

FileName

Data type String

HeightAllowed

Data type Real32

Maximum height of an adapter card that can be inserted into the slot, in inches.

InstallDate

Data type DateTime

The InstallDate property is datetime value indicating when the object was installed. A lack of a value does not indicate that the object is not installed.

LengthAllowed

Data type Real32

Maximum length of an adapter card that can be inserted into the slot, in inches.

Manufacturer

Data type String

The name of the organization responsible for producing the physical element. This may be the entity from whom the element is purchased, but this is not necessarily $true. The latter information is contained in the Vendor property of CIM_Product.

MaxDataWidth

Data type UInt16

The MaxDataWidth property returns the maximum bus width of adapter cards that can be inserted into this slot, in bits. The value of the property is to be interpreted as follows:

0 for 8

1 for 16

2 for 32

3 for 64

4 for 128

$MaxDataWidth_ReturnValue = 
@{
    0='8'
    1='16'
    2='32'
    3='64'
    4='128'
}

Model

Data type String

The name by which the physical element is generally known.

Name

Data type String

The Name property defines the label by which the object is known. When subclassed, the Name property can be overridden to be a Key property.

Number

Data type UInt16

The Number property indicates the physical slot number, which can be used as an index into a system slot table, whether or not that slot is physically occupied.

OtherIdentifyingInfo

Data type String

OtherIdentifyingInfo captures additional data, beyond asset tag information, that could be used to identify a physical element. One example is bar code data associated with an element that also has an asset tag. Note that if only bar code data is available and is unique/able to be used as an element key, this property would be NULL and the bar code data used as the class key, in the tag property.

PartNumber

Data type String

The part number assigned by the organization responsible for producing or manufacturing the physical element.

PMESignal

Data type Boolean

The PMESignal property indicates whether the PCI bus Power Management Enabled signal is supported by this slot. PMESignal will be $false for non-PCI slots. If $true, then the Power Management Enabled signal is supported.

PoweredOn

Data type Boolean

Boolean indicating that the physical element is powered on ($true), or is currently off ($false).

PurposeDescription

Data type String

A free-form string describing that this slot is physically unique and may hold special types of hardware. This property only has meaning when the corresponding boolean property, SpecialPurpose, is set to $true.

SerialNumber

Data type String

A manufacturer-allocated number used to identify the PhysicalElement.

Shared

Data type Boolean

The Shared property indicates whether the two or more slots shared a location on the base board such as a PCI/EISA shared slot.

Values: $true or $false. If $true, the slot is shared.

SKU

Data type String

The stock keeping unit number for this physical element.

SlotDesignation

Data type String

The SlotDesignation property contains an SMBIOS string that identifies the system slot designation of the slot on the motherboard.

Example: PCI-1

SpecialPurpose

Data type Boolean

Boolean indicating that this slot is physically unique and may hold special types of hardware, e.g. a graphics processor slot. If set to $true, then the property, PurposeDescription property (a string), should specify the nature of the uniqueness or purpose of the slot.

Status

Data type String

The Status property is a string indicating the current status of the object. Various operational and non-operational statuses can be defined. Operational statuses are “OK”, “Degraded” and “Pred Fail”. “Pred Fail” indicates that an element may be functioning properly but predicting a failure in the near future. An example is a SMART-enabled hard drive. Non-operational statuses can also be specified. These are “Error”, “Starting”, “Stopping” and “Service”. The latter, “Service”, could apply during mirror-resilvering of a disk, reload of a user permissions list, or other administrative work. Not all such work is on-line, yet the managed element is neither “OK” nor in one of the other states.

'OK','Error','Degraded','Unknown','Pred Fail','Starting','Stopping','Service','Stressed','NonRecover','No Contact','Lost Comm'

SupportsHotPlug

Data type Boolean

Boolean indicating whether the slot supports hot-plug of adapter cards.

Tag

Data type String

The Tag property uniquely identifies the system slot represented by an instance of this class.

Example: System Slot 1

ThermalRating

Data type UInt32

Maximum thermal dissipation of the slot in milliwatts.

VccMixedVoltageSupport

Data type UInt16

An array of enumerated integers indicating the Vcc voltage supported by this slot.

Version

Data type String

A string indicating the version of the physical element.

VppMixedVoltageSupport

Data type UInt16

An array of enumerated integers indicating the Vpp voltage supported by this slot.

Methods

Examples

Help and Questions

  Community Content

You are cordially invited to add knowledge to this page. If you have sample code or additional information related to this WMI class, please share it. Use the comment form to send your information. We will edit and incorparate it into the reference library. Thank you!

Please do not use the comment form to submit questions. If you have questions or need assistance, visit our free forum: Help me with WMI.

Content last updated: 2013-12-27 12:25:52 (UTC).

Facebooktwittergoogle_pluspinterestlinkedinFacebooktwittergoogle_pluspinterestlinkedin